A Unique Approach to Restaurant Acquisitions
Unlike many restaurant conglomerates focused on rapid, volume-based acquisitions, Craveworthy Brands employs a more deliberate strategy. Instead of simply buying brands and imposing a standardized model, they prioritize collaboration with existing management teams. This approach preserves individual brand identities, fostering organic growth and minimizing integration challenges. This strategic choice, prioritizing partnerships over pure acquisition, is a key differentiator in the competitive restaurant landscape.
Craveworthy Brands' Recipe for Success
Several key factors fuel Craveworthy's impressive growth:
- Experienced Leadership and Team: Majewski has assembled a team rich in restaurant industry expertise, crucial for navigating the complexities of acquisitions and expansion.
- Strategic Acquisitions and Brand Preservation: Targeted acquisitions focusing on brands with growth potential, combined with a sensitive approach to brand integration, contributes to organic growth and market share.
- Empowered Franchisees: The model encourages franchisees to expand their ownership, increasing the company's footprint organically, bolstering brand loyalty and local market penetration.
- Streamlined Operational Efficiency: Focus on improving operational efficiency translates to increased profitability across the entire brand portfolio, benefiting both Craveworthy Brands and its franchise partners.
